Cep'te Kolluk, polis, jandarma, sahil güvenlik ve çarşı/mahalle bekçileri için özel olarak geliştirilmiş, Türkiye'nin ilk yapay zeka destekli dijital kolluk asistanıdır. Göreviniz sırasında ihtiyaç duyduğunuz tüm operasyonel ve yasal araçları tek bir merkezde toplayarak "Dijital Karargâhınızı" cebinize taşıyor. Siz sahada adaleti tesis ederken, bırakın evrak işlerini yapay zeka halletsin! ÖNE ÇIKAN ÖZELLİKLER: • Yapay Zeka Destekli İfade Motoru: Olayın kısa bir özetini girin, Yapay Zeka altyapısı CMK ve PVSK'ya tam uyumlu, resmi kolluk jargonuyla yazılmış kusursuz ifade tutanaklarını saniyeler içinde hazırlasın. • Tutanak Motoru: Basit Evrak İşleri İçin Karakola Dönmeye Son! Tutanak motoru sayesinde aklınıza gelebilecek her şeyi tutanağa bağlayabilirsiniz. • Trafik Personelleri İçin Gelişmiş Araçlar: Trafik Görevlilerinin sahada eli ayağı olacağı, en kısa sürede iş bitirme odaklı araçla…

What the numbers say: Cep'te Kolluk runs a dark set with one background colour (#040C1C) carried across every screenshot — the listing reads as a single poster when the shots sit side by side in search results. The accent colour we picked up, #244474, is the one to reuse for badges, arrows and highlighted words if you borrow this look.
